Holographic 3D Printing Has the Potential to Revolutionize A number of Industries, Researchers Reveal


Muthukumaran Packirisamy says real-world functions for holographic 3D printing embrace the creation of latest types of pores and skin grafts and improved drug supply – credit score, Concordia College.

Researchers have developed a novel technique of 3D printing that makes use of acoustic holograms, and whereas it’s slightly technical and obscure, the invention may be a paradigm shift.

The researchers say it’s faster than current strategies and able to making extra complicated objects because the sound waves assist cancel out sure limitations imposed by gravity and kind the item at a steady price reasonably than “voxel by voxel” (a voxel is the 3D equal of a pixel, although maybe ought to have been known as a ‘boxel.’)

The method, known as holographic direct sound printing (HDSP) builds on a way launched in 2022 that described how tiny bubbles create extraordinarily excessive temperatures and stress for trillionths of a second to harden resin into complicated patterns.

Now, by embedding the approach in acoustic holograms that include cross-sectional pictures of a selected design, polymerization happens rather more rapidly.

It has been described in a current article within the journal Nature Communications, and elaborated in a video produced by Concordia that needs to be watched to be believed.

With a purpose to retain the constancy of the specified picture, the hologram stays stationary inside the printing materials. The printing platform is hooked up to a robotic arm, which strikes it based mostly on a pre-programmed algorithm-designed sample that can kind the finished object.

Muthukumaran Packirisamy, a professor within the Division of Mechanical, Industrial, and Aerospace Engineering at Concordia College in Montreal, believes this will enhance printing velocity by as much as 20 occasions whereas on the similar time utilizing much less vitality.

“We will additionally change the picture whereas the operation is underway,” he advised the Concordia press group. “We will change shapes, mix a number of motions, and alter supplies being printed. We will make a sophisticated construction by controlling the feed price if we optimize the parameters to get the required constructions.”

In response to the researchers, the exact management of acoustic holograms permits it to retailer data of a number of pictures in a single hologram. This implies a number of objects could be printed on the similar time at completely different places inside the similar printing area.

Consequently, acoustic holography can be a launching pad for innovation throughout any variety of fields: it may be used to create complicated tissue constructions, localized drug and cell supply programs, and superior tissue engineering. Actual-world functions embrace the creation of latest types of pores and skin grafts that may improve therapeutic, and improved drug supply for therapies that require particular therapeutic brokers at particular websites.

He provides that, as soundwaves can penetrate opaque surfaces, HSDP can be utilized to print inside a physique or behind strong materials. This may be useful in repairing broken organs or delicate components positioned deep inside an airplane.

The researchers imagine that HDSP has the potential to be a paradigm-shifting expertise. He compares it to the development light-based 3D printing expertise noticed with the evolution from stereolithography, through which a laser is used to harden a single level of resin right into a strong object, to digital mild processing, which cures whole layers of resin concurrently.

“You may think about the chances,” he says. “We will print behind opaque objects, behind a wall, inside a tube, or contained in the physique. The approach that we already use and the gadgets that we use have already been accepted for medical functions.”
